解决tpWallet接口调通问题的全面指南

    <dl dropzone="glj1p07"></dl><abbr lang="w6m20d4"></abbr><center id="ea65532"></center><em id="ytubi_x"></em><var draggable="y4fwu3h"></var><noscript lang="2v9q6oj"></noscript><abbr draggable="2lbzevr"></abbr><pre dir="5pp6cfl"></pre><var dir="g1e26uf"></var><bdo dir="c525rgw"></bdo>
    发布时间:2025-06-02 13:36:47
    --- ### 引言 在区块链技术日益发展的今天,加密数字货币的使用也越来越普及。作为一款功能强大的加密钱包,tpWallet为用户提供了多样化的功能,包括资产存储和交易信息管理等。然而,在使用tpWallet的过程中,很多开发者和用户在接口调试时会遇到一些问题,这影响了他们的使用体验和开发进度。本文将详细介绍如何解决tpWallet的一部分接口调不通的问题,并对常见的相关问题进行解答。 ### tpWallet接口调不通的原因 在使用tpWallet的过程中,接口调不通的问题可能源于多个方面。首先,我们需要确保网络连接正常,接口服务正常运行。其次,所有的请求需要符合tpWallet API的文档规范,参数必须正确无误。此外,还可能出现授权配置、接口版本不匹配等问题。 #### 1. 网络连接问题 网络连接是影响接口调用的首要因素。在稳定的网络环境下,接口请求才能成功向tpWallet服务器发送且接收正确的响应。如果网络不稳定,可能会导致请求超时或无响应。 #### 2. 请求参数不正确 根据tpWallet官方文档,接口请求必须包含所有必须的参数。缺少任何一个参数,或者传递了无效的参数,都会导致接口调用失败。因此,在编写请求时应仔细检查每一个参数的名称和类型。 #### 3. 认证问题 tpWallet的接口通常需要进行身份验证,例如使用API密钥或令牌。如果没有正确配置这些凭证,接口将无法成功访问。确保在请求中添加了有效的认证信息。 #### 4. 接口版本不匹配 tpWallet可能会更新其API版本,如果你的请求仍然指向旧版本的接口,可能会导致不兼容的问题。检查文档中指定的当前版本,并确保你的请求代码也进行了相应的更新。 ### 可能相关的问题 在了解tpWallet接口调不通的原因后,接下来我们将探讨一些常见的相关问题。 #### 如何确认接口服务正常运行? 在调试接口时,确认tpWallet的接口服务是否正常运行至关重要。以下是一些可以帮助确认接口服务状态的方法:

    检查官方网站和文档

    首先,访问tpWallet的官方网站和官方文档,许多钱包服务会在其网站上提供服务状态的实时更新。例如,tpWallet可能会有专门的状态页面,列出当前所有服务的运行状态。

    使用API状态监测工具

     解决tpWallet接口调通问题的全面指南

    许多开发者使用API状态监测工具(如Postman、Insomnia等)可以手动发送请求,查看接口的响应时间和状态码。这些工具会显示每次请求的结果,帮助开发者快速识别问题所在。

    查看开发者论坛和社区反馈

    很多时候,其他用户可能已经报告了相似的接口问题。通过访问相关的开发者论坛、社区或社交媒体平台,可以获得其他用户的反馈信息,从而判断问题的普遍性以及解决方案。

    #### 如何调试请求参数? 确保请求参数的正确性是调试接口的重要一步。调试请求参数的步骤如下:

    查阅官方文档

     解决tpWallet接口调通问题的全面指南

    tpWallet的官方API文档将详细列出每个接口所需的参数及其名称、类型和必需性。在发送请求之前,务必仔细阅读文档,确保所有必需的参数都已正确提供。

    进行数据类型检查

    在构建请求时,确保传递的每个参数都符合其预期的数据类型。比如,某些参数可能要求为字符串,更加需要注意不要错传。例如,ID字段字符串类型不能传入数字类型。

    测试典型的成功请求

    在调试过程中,可以通过构建一个完整、正确的请求模板,然后在线发送请求。获取成功响应后,可以对比你的请求与原请求的差异,逐步排查问题。

    使用调试工具进行捕获

    使用网络请求调试工具,如Chrome开发者工具,可以捕获请求和响应的详细信息。不同的状态码会提供线索,如果返回状态码是400或500,说明请求有误,让你可以清晰地快速定位问题。

    #### 如何设置API认证信息? 通用的API认证方式通常包括API密钥、OAuth令牌等。tpWallet也不例外,配置认证信息是确保接口通畅的关键步骤。

    申请API密钥

    首先,在tpWallet官方网站上注册一个开发者账户,然后申请API密钥。确保将密钥存储在安全的地方,避免泄漏。在大多数情况下,API密钥会在账户的个人资料或设置页面中生成。

    加入认证信息到请求

    将API密钥和请求结合时,务必按照官方文档指定的格式进行嵌入。通常情况下,API密钥需要在HTTP请求的头中进行添加,无论是使用GET请求还是POST请求。

    从服务端获取错误信息

    如果添加了密钥但依然无法访问接口,建立一套处理错误响应的机制,例如,当303、401或403等状态码返回时,要及时查看错误信息,确认API密钥是否过期或被撤销。

    安全存储与管理

    确保你的API密钥不会暴露在公共的代码库中,例如GitHub。使用环境变量或配置文件来存储API密钥,确保干净而安全的代码环境。

    #### 如何处理接口版本不匹配的情况? 在软件更新频繁的时代,接口版本不匹配是常见的开发痛点之一。解决此类问题的策略包括:

    定期检查文档更新

    保持对tpWallet官方文档的关注,尤其是API的更新日志。很多时候,官方会在文档中提供变更记录,说明每个版本的新增、改动或弃用项目。

    使用版本控制的API请求

    在请求中明确指定API版本是非常重要的。如果tpWallet支持版本号,务必在请求的URL中指定,例如:`https://api.tpwallet.com/v1/endpoint`。确保使用的是当前最新的URL路径。

    适应新版本的开发计划

    对于开发者来说,不仅要在开发环境中使用最新版本的API,还应当建立一个规范,以便快速迁移到新的API版本。例如,可以编写一个适配器来处理不同版本的请求和响应,以便应对任何API的更改。

    版本回退的考虑

    若发现新版API存在BUG或不稳定时,可以暂时回退至之前的信息版本,直到修复补丁发布并确保服务正常运行。并且,要定期测试现有代码在新版本下的表现。

    ### 结论 在使用tpWallet的过程中,接口调不通是一个复杂但可以解决的问题。本文通过分析原因,归纳经验方法,帮助开发者和用户有效地排除故障。希望通过分享这些经验,能帮助更多的人在使用tpWallet时,增强其开发体验与应用效果。通过持续的学习和,用户能够更高效、更稳定地使用tpWallet,实现加密资产的安全管理。
    分享 :
      
          
      author

      tpwallet

      T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                    相关新闻

                    如何使用tpWallet进行收款:
                    2025-05-23
                    如何使用tpWallet进行收款:

                    在数字货币迅猛发展的今天,越来越多的人开始关注如何安全、便捷地进行加密货币的交易与收款。tpWallet作为一款新...

                    思考一个符合用户搜索并
                    2024-08-19
                    思考一个符合用户搜索并

                    标签里,然后围绕标题详细介绍,写不少于5000个字的内容,并思考4个可能相关的问题,并逐个问题详细介绍,每个问...

                    比特派钱包和TP哪个安全可
                    2024-08-12
                    比特派钱包和TP哪个安全可

                    介绍比特派钱包 比特派钱包是一款知名的数字货币钱包,旨在为用户提供安全、可靠的区块链资产管理和交易体验。...

                    标题: tpWallet密码重置指南
                    2024-09-07
                    标题: tpWallet密码重置指南

                    ### 介绍随着数字货币的流行,越来越多的人开始使用各种加密货币钱包进行资产管理。tpWallet作为一个安全、便捷的...